Begin by entering the tenant's name and address at the top of the letter. This personalizes the communication and ensures clarity.
Fill in the date of the letter, as well as the expected move-out date. This establishes a timeline for both parties.
In the body of the letter, clearly outline the cleaning expectations. Use bullet points to list specific areas that need attention, such as floors, walls, and kitchen appliances.
Include reminders about disconnecting utilities and changing addresses. This helps tenants remember important tasks before moving out.
Provide your contact information for any questions or clarifications. This fosters open communication and support.
Finally, ensure you sign off with your name and title at the bottom of the letter to maintain professionalism.
